Philip I, (A.D. 244-249), AE sestertius, Rome Mint, issued A.D. 244-245, (17.51 g), obv. laureate bust of Philip I to right draped and cuirassed, around IMP M IVL PHILIPPVS AVG, rev. around VICTORIA AVG, S C across field, Victory to right, with palm over shoulder and wreath in hand, (S.9020, RIC 191a, C.228). Green patination, good very fine - nearly extremely fine, scarce.

Ex Dr V.J.A. Flynn Collection.
